I used to cool the wine (on those rare occasion one was trying to cool it, rather than stop it from freezing!), by putting bottle (alongside unopened milk, etc.) in a plastic carrier bag dangled in the sea by a bit of rope.

Milk already opened, butter, etc. would be cooled by evaporation - a bucket, in whatever was the shadiest bit of the cockpit at the time, with a bit of water in the bottom, and a wet teacloth draped over the contents to be cooled and reaching into the water.
